Output 57fa0f17d86b30cf3d9e37ab4a6aa5e163af582878a66db5179c7c72b7f1212b:1

value
29204561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8188962b3f9a65d4a49858ae1860933bbf1dfc5 OP_EQUAL
address
3Kw2TkHFAcjbTo5hqymNfe7S6NzqWPvFMW
transaction
57fa0f17d86b30cf3d9e37ab4a6aa5e163af582878a66db5179c7c72b7f1212b
spent
true